A train accident can be caused by a number of causes which include human error, or negligence of railroad companies. A person could be held accountable for damages if it acted negligently. Damages to property, medical expenses, lost wages and pain and suffering are some of the various types.

Derailments, collisions, as well as trains that strike pedestrians or other workers are the most common train accidents. Derailments are often caused by track defects and weld issues, but also due to speeding or other reasons. Accidents between trains are common and can lead to serious injuries.

Train accidents can also release dangerous substances. These materials can have diverse consequences. For example toxic fumes can be a source of contamination for the air and cause illnesses. Chemicals can penetrate the ground to contaminate water sources or soil. These spills can also cause damage to structures and cause harm to wildlife. They could also pose a threat to businesses in towns forced to close to clean up.

When a train accident occurs, there are often multiple parties who could be responsible. These include the train company, the railway track owner, and the manufacturers of any faulty equipment that caused the accident. You could be able to also sue the government when the accident occurred on public property.

Train accidents can occur for various reasons. These include mechanical failure, human error or a lack of security measures taken by train injury claim employees. It is crucial to keep in mind that the majority of train crashes aren't the result of negligence on the part of railway companies or train employees. They are usually caused by other parties, such as distracted or reckless drivers who attempt to beat an railroad crossing, or drive into the tracks, or ignore railroad safety procedures.

Railroad companies owe a greater obligation to their passengers than other transportation companies because they are considered to be common carriers. To protect their passengers they must adhere to strict safety rules and procedures. Injured people are the result of when they don't follow.
